About Shamsher Mohmand

Shamsher Mohmand is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Spectroscopy and Toxicology, having authored 17 papers that have together received 650 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Inorganic and Organometallic Chemistry (7 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(7 papers), Molecular Spectroscopy and Structure (4 papers), Organic Chemistry Cycloaddition Reactions (3 papers), Chemical Thermodynamics and Molecular Structure (3 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(2 papers), Inorganic Fluorides and Related Compounds (2 papers) and Chemical Reaction Mechanisms (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Polymers and Plastics (165 citations), Bioengineering (61 citations) and Organic Chemistry (310 citations). Shamsher Mohmand has collaborated with scholars based in Germany and United States. Frequent co-authors include Hans Bock, Takakuni Hirabayashi, R. J. Waltman, Joachim Bargon, Bahman Solouki, P. Rosmus, Eric Block, Günther Maier and Hans Peter Reisenauer.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, The Journal of Organic Chemistry and IBM Journal of Research and Development.
